Definition of systéllō
συστέλλω (systéllō) — to send (draw) together, i.e. enwrap (enshroud a corpse for burial), contract (an interval)
Word Origin
This word comes from G4862 (σύν) and G4724 (στέλλω); See the root words: G4862 (σύν), G4724 (στέλλω).
